Hi everyone, I have a Scope survey for all community members to take part in. It's about eLearning. 


What is eLearning? eLearning is learning or training using online resources on your computer or mobile phone. You might do it by yourself in your own time. You could also do it in an online session supported by a teacher or adviser.

Scope are creating a new eLearning platform for customers of our employment services, to make sure disabled people get the right training.
